Happy National Hot Dog Day, Boston! Given the number of tweets and mentions regarding the holiday, it’s clear that we’re enthusiastic about our hot dogs – especially Fenway Franks. And in honor of the tasty holiday, Kayem, the official Frank and Sausage of the Boston Red Sox and Fenway Park, hosted a “Create the Next Fenway Frank” contest.

The contest happened earlier today at The Landing at Long Wharf, where the company held a special lunchtime celebration with free hot dogs. Red Sox icons Steve Lyons and Rico Petrocelli were also on-hand to announce the grand prize winner, whose home run hot dog will be sold within Fenway Park throughout the summer, notes an official source.

The “lucky dogs” that went to head to head in today’s competition included the “Greenville Southern Drive Dog” and “The Monstah”. The winner was the Greenville Southern Drive Dog which came topped with warm, smoky pulled pork and creamy coleslaw. The runner-up, The Monstah hot dog, was topped with Boston baked beans, honey mustard, warm sweet onion, sharp cheddar cheese, and crispy smokey bacon bits.

According to a source, the winning hot dog will be honored on-field at a Red Sox game next Monday, July 28. You can also try the hot dog for yourself all summer long at Fenway Park.
